我正在使用SpringBoot配置Consul并在此处找到documentation。即使浏览了其他资源,也没有找到额外的配置或方案。
因此,我很好奇当springboot app与consul集成时,是否只有这些配置可用。我想深入了解,任何人都可以告诉我任何其他可用的物业?
答案 0 :(得分:3)
这些是可用的属性。
这些用于
org.springframework.cloud.consul.config.ConsulConfigProperties
,org.springframework.cloud.consul.discovery.ConsulDiscoveryProperties
。
查看正在使用哪个属性的最佳位置,以查看任何模块的自动配置。例如,对于Mongo,请检查MongoAutoConfiguration
和MongoDataAutoConfiguration
。同样,对于领事检查ConsulAutoConfiguration
答案 1 :(得分:0)
此页面将提供配置属性
https://docs.spring.io/spring-boot/docs/current/reference/html/common-application-properties.html
此外,您还可以在IDE中看到配置属性。如果您使用的是IntelliJ或STS / Eclipse,请转到application.yml文件,按Ctrl +空格可以查看和查看可用的配置。它会给出建议。